Innovative Approaches to Ensuring Fairness and Security
Leading operators now adopt cutting-edge verification methods to foster trust. For instance, some employ cryptographic techniques such as provably fair algorithms, which enable players to verify game fairness independently. Additionally, third-party audit firms conduct random checks to ensure compliance with fairness standards.
One notable example is the inclusion of blockchain technology, allowing for immutable records of game outcomes, deposit transactions, and payout processes, which further increases transparency. Such innovations are crucial in differentiating reputable platforms from less scrupulous competitors.
